The last picture I took after trying for days and days to get a good shot. All of the wiring in Japan is above ground, and it proved to be a real challenge!

*Greetings From the Critique Club!* :D

Fantastic image you got here, something to be proud of.

Composition:

I believe this is by far your strongest element of the photo. The way you have it set up, with the angle and all, makes it look like you carefully considered what elements were needed in the shot and where they should be placed, you have done a nice job here. It is well framed by the plants surrounding the shot and really enhances. Using framing techniques like this can really enhance a shot, especiallly the outdoor shots. Excellent focus as well.

Lighting and Color:

According to the commenters/slash voters, it appears that this is the most controversial part of this shot. Sepia, desaturation, and color is one of those arbitrary things when it comes to voting, mostly due to the fact that it is highly subjective to personal taste. However, I can tell you my personal preference as far as this shot goes. I honestly would havbe liked to see this shot in color. I believe the color can tell so much about a place, especially in the "Where You Live Challenge." When I think about this challenge, the word culture pops into my mind, and when I think of culture, I think of diversity and variety, and I think color has a lot to do with that in the shot. The sepia does work, don't be discopurage dabout that, you did a nice job with that. I am just telling you my PERSONAL preference and trying to give an objective opinion.

Other Thoughts:

A very nicely composed shot that has some very pleasing elements and enjoyable to look at. Good luck in future challenges and hope to see some more of your work doing well.
